A brief comparative study is presented regarding different exergy efficiency correlations of solar photovoltaic/thermal (PV/T) system that have been proposed in the literature. Performance evaluation results of a certain PV/T hybrid system are found to be inconsistent with each other when using different correlations of exergy efficiency. It is mainly due to that no consensus has been reached in the calculation of thermal exergy, solar radiation exergy and other causal factors. Also, the issues that need to be further investigated are briefly discussed. This study will be beneficial to the design and performance assessment of PV/T hybrid system.
